Handover Note — Orrin to Salome

Quick one: the Fennick Supplies contract renews in March. They've hinted at a 6% bump, but volumes justify pushing back. Finance has the old pricing schedule. Don't let it auto-renew — there's a 60-day notice window. The bigger picture on where this fits is below.

internal memo for bahap-yagug: Headcount on the Ulaix team goes from 3 to 100 by the end of January. Gross margin on Ulaix came in at 10 percent against a plan of 15 percent.

Tuning notes for Threadlark, our request-tracing layer across the Ovenbird microservices, prepared for the weekly eng sync. Sampling is adaptive: high-traffic routes drop to a baseline rate while error paths are always captured. Span buffers flush on size or interval, whichever comes first, and oversized traces are truncated rather than dropped so partial context survives. If you change any of these, coordinate with the storage team, since retention costs scale directly. The current production constants are below.

tuning table, kajog-kawef:
PRIORITIES = {
    "kelox": 870,
    "kasix": 89,
    "eliax": 988,
}

Ticket #88: Badge system migration, night-shift notice. Over the weekend, Fenwick Row is moving from the old Keystone readers to the new Ardale panels. Night staff should expect the lift lobby readers to be offline between 01:00 and 04:00 on Saturday. During this window, use the stairwell doors only, and log every entry in the paper register at the guard desk. Legacy badges will stop working once the cutover completes. Until your replacement badge arrives, the night crew should use the interim code below.

door code, yageg-yagap: bdg-DNN-9

## Ownership

The LockerLink access flow handles badge scans, locker assignment, and door release for the SpinCycle laundry lockers. Changes to the release-token logic require review from the access team. Do not modify the retry window without checking the hardware timeout docs in `docs/hardware.md`. New joiners: read the flow diagram before touching anything. All questions about this flow go to the person named below.

account owner for kafop-haweg: Pelax Gilael Istir